Recipe Recommendations

  • Muscovy duck half branch
  • ginger a
  • salt a teaspoon
  • sugar two teaspoons
  • soy sauce a teaspoon
  • rice wine appropriate amount
  • rice vinegar appropriate amount

Steps for stir-fried muscovy duck with wild game wine and wine aroma

  • Make  step 0
    1
    Wash the muscovy duck and cut it into pieces.
  • Make  step 1
    2
    Peel the ginger, cut it into thin slices, put it in a frying pan and saute until fragrant.
  • Make  step 2
    3
    Pour in the duck pieces and stir fry for a while.
  • Make  step 3
    4
    Add salt, sugar, soy sauce and rice wine and stir fry until fragrant.
  • Make  step 4
    5
    In addition, adding a little rice vinegar can also help remove the fishy smell of duck.
  • Make  step 5
    6
    Finally, add a lot of water (almost no more than the duck pieces), bring to a boil over high heat, and then turn to medium to medium heat and simmer.
  • Make  step 6
    7
    Simmer until the water dries.
